Singapore's most iconic building features the world-famous rooftop infinity pool with sweeping views of the city skyline. Marina Bay Sands is more than a hotel; it is a destination with a casino, celebrity chef restaurants, and the ArtScience Museum. Fans splurge here for the ultimate Singapore experience.
